Imam Ali (ع), a Democratic Approach to the Governmet and its Origin
This article discusses the theoretical and practical foundations of religious democracy as an achievement of the Islamic Republic of Iran, which has introduced some new terminology and concepts in the political discourse of Iran in recent years. To this end, some necessary measures taken to actualize religious democracy like the role afforded to people in the election of their rulers following the model of Imam Ali (ع) as the embodiment of the Holy Quran and the Prophet's Tradition, are being considered. This would clarify the differences between religious and liberalistic democracy.
